Congrats to UFC's new LHW champion.
Congratulations Shogun, great performance, glad to see you're back to form and glad to see you finally recognized as the champ.
You beat a tough, seemingly unbeatable guy. No one could figure him out, much less hurt him. You did both. You wrote a text book out there on what to do when you fight Machida, problem is, there may not be anyone else in the world that has the ability to follow that strategy. You may be the only one who could do what you just did.
Your strategy was perfect, your execution was perfect, your cardio was off the charts. Just a terrific performance. Way to go champ
War Shogun, new UFC LHW champ and the number one LHW in the world
